SUBJECT
Title
RESOLUTION - Approving the Final Map of Tract No. 5571 and accepting dedicated public uses offered therein -east side of N. Armstrong Avenue between E. Dakota Avenue and E. Shields Avenue (Council District 4)
Body
RECOMMENDATION
Subject to the City Council's action to approve the annexation of the proposed Final Map of Tract No. 5571 into the City's Community Facilities District which is scheduled on today's agenda, that upon such approval, staff recommends the City Council adopt a resolution approving the Final Map of Tract No. 5571 and accepting the dedicated public uses offered therein and to authorize the Public Works Director or his designee to execute the subdivision agreement on behalf of the City.
Should the Council not approve the annexation of the Final Map of Tract No. 5571 into the City's Community Facilities District, Council's action on the approval of the Final Map must be delayed.
EXECUTIVE SUMMARY
The Subdivider, The Patrick Vincent Ricchiuti Family Trust, (Patrick Vincent Ricchiuti, Trustee), has filed for approval, the Final Map of Tract No. 5571, Phase 1 of Vesting Tentative Map No. 5571, for a 97-lot single-family residential subdivision with one outlot for future development, located on east side of North Armstrong Avenue between East Dakota Avenue and East Shields Avenue on 26.10 acres.
